Transaction 886de19ad30b760205599268c144c3921a724b8e91e39d80e105705fbc7f7aa0
1 Input
1 Output
-
886de19ad30b760205599268c144c3921a724b8e91e39d80e105705fbc7f7aa0:0
- value
- 170954
- script pubkey
- OP_0 OP_PUSHBYTES_20 52c32fc7f543328b1cc19728790c603eac2d5477
- address
- bc1q2tpjl3l4gvegk8xpju58jrrq86kz64rhruzfrq